> > When the guest triggers vhost_stop and then virtio_reset, the vector will 
> > the
> > IRQFD for this vector will be released and change to VIRTIO_NO_VECTOR.
> > After that, the guest called vhost_net_start,  (at this time, the configure
> > vector is still VIRTIO_NO_VECTOR),  vector 0 still was not "init".
> > The guest system continued to boot, set the vector back to 0, and then met 
> > the crash.
> >
> > To fix this, we need to call the function "kvm_virtio_pci_vector_use_one()"
> > when the vector changes back from VIRTIO_NO_VECTOR

> kvm_virtio_pci_vq_vector_use() has a similar check and it looks to me
> kvm_virtio_pci_irqfd_use() can work when users > 0.
>
> Any reason we need an extra check here?
>
> Thanks
>
in function kvm_virtio_pci_vq_vector_use(). this will not init the
irqfd, but there will be an
    irqfd->users++;
so the user number will be wrong in this irqfd, There will be check
for this in other function
sunch like kvm_virtio_pci_vq_vector_release()
{
    VirtIOIRQFD *irqfd = &proxy->vector_irqfd[vector];

    if (--irqfd->users == 0) {
        kvm_irqchip_release_virq(kvm_state, irqfd->virq);
    }
}
this will cause problem
